Foxmetrics features and specs

  • Real-Time Analytics
    Foxmetrics provides real-time data tracking and reporting, which allows businesses to make timely decisions based on the most current data available.
  • Customization
    The platform offers extensive customization options for both data collection and reporting, enabling users to tailor the analytics to their specific needs.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The intuitive and easy-to-navigate interface makes it simple for users of all technical backgrounds to utilize the tools effectively.
  • Integration Capabilities
    Foxmetrics supports seamless integration with various third-party tools and platforms, enhancing its functionality and allowing for a more comprehensive data analysis.
  • Customer Support
    The platform offers robust customer support, including detailed documentation and responsive support teams, to assist users in resolving issues quickly.

Sourcegraph for GitHub features and specs

  • Enhanced Code Search
    Sourcegraph offers powerful code search capabilities, allowing users to search across multiple repositories and find specific code snippets quickly.
  • Seamless Integration
    It integrates seamlessly with GitHub, providing a more cohesive experience for developers who rely on GitHub for version control.
  • Cross-repository Navigation
    Sourcegraph enables users to navigate across repositories, which is particularly useful for projects that span multiple codebases.
  • Code Intelligence
    Provides code intelligence features such as hover tooltips and go-to-definition, improving the understanding of large and complex codebases.
  • Collaboration Features
    Sourcegraph enhances collaboration by allowing teams to share links to code, improving communication and code review processes.

Possible disadvantages of Sourcegraph for GitHub

  • Performance Issues
    Some users may experience performance lags, especially when dealing with large repositories or complex codebases.
  • Learning Curve
    New users may face a learning curve to utilize all the features effectively, which may deter those looking for a quick setup.
  • Limited Offline Access
    Sourcegraph primarily functions online, making it less useful for developers working in environments with limited internet connectivity.
  • Dependency on Browsers
    Being a browser-based extension, it may lack some of the features available in standalone code editors or IDEs.
  • Privacy Concerns
    Some users might be concerned about privacy and security, as Sourcegraph handles code browsing data, which may include sensitive information.
